Key Features to Look For
When you shop for a Total Gym, keep these important things in mind.
- Weight Capacity: How much weight can the machine hold? Make sure it’s enough for you and anyone else who might use it. Most Total Gyms can handle over 300 pounds.
- Resistance Levels: This is how you make your workout harder or easier. Look for a machine with plenty of resistance options. This lets you grow stronger over time.
- Workout Variety: Can you do lots of different exercises on it? A good Total Gym lets you work out your whole body. It should be able to do exercises for your arms, legs, chest, back, and abs.
- Folding and Storage: Do you have a lot of space? Some Total Gyms fold up neatly. This makes them easy to store when you’re not using them.
- Included Accessories: Does it come with extras like a leg pull, a Pilates bar, or an ab crunch board? These can add even more exercises you can do.
Important Materials
The stuff a Total Gym is made of matters. It affects how strong and safe it is.
- Steel Frame: Most good Total Gyms have a strong steel frame. Steel is tough and lasts a long time. It holds up well to lots of workouts.
- Padding: The seat and any other padded parts should be comfortable. Good padding uses high-density foam. This keeps you comfy even during long workouts.
- Rollers: The sliding parts need to be smooth. Good rollers are made of strong plastic or rubber. They glide easily without sticking.
Factors That Affect Quality
Some things make a Total Gym better, and others can make it less good.
- Smoothness of the Glide Board: Does the board slide up and down easily? A smooth glide means a better workout. If it sticks, your exercise won’t be as effective.
- Sturdiness: Does the machine feel solid when you use it? A wobbly machine isn’t safe. A sturdy one feels strong and reliable.
- Ease of Adjustment: Can you change the resistance and set up exercises quickly? If it’s hard to change things, you might not want to use it as much.
- Durability: Will it last for years? Well-made Total Gyms with good materials tend to last longer.

Frequently Asked Questions About Home Total Gyms
Q: What is a Total Gym?
A: A Total Gym is a home exercise machine. It uses your body weight for resistance. You can do many different exercises on it to work your whole body.

Q: How do I adjust the resistance on a Total Gym?
A: The resistance comes from how much of your body weight you use. You adjust it by changing the angle of the machine. A steeper angle means more resistance.
